Quick Comparison

Smaller 12-cup brewers are best for office kitchens, departments, and smaller teams that want fresh pots throughout the day. Mid-size urns work well for meeting rooms, shared break areas, and events. Large 100-cup models are better suited to high-traffic workplaces, catering, and environments where a single brew needs to serve many people at once.

Key Buying Factors for Commercial Coffee Makers for Workplaces

Capacity

Match the tank or pot size to your average headcount and coffee consumption. A unit that is too small creates bottlenecks, while an oversized urn may waste energy and coffee.

Brew Speed and Recovery

Fast brew cycles matter during morning rushes and meetings. If your team drinks coffee all day, check how quickly the machine can brew another batch after the first one is served.

Warmers and Heat Retention

For drip systems, warming plates help keep coffee ready without constant rebrewing. For urns, double-wall construction and insulated designs can improve heat retention and reduce temperature swings.

Ease of Use and Cleaning

Simple fill, brew, and dispense controls reduce training time and user error. Removable parts, accessible spouts, and stainless steel interiors can make cleanup faster for staff or facilities teams.

Durability and Safety

Commercial settings put equipment under heavier use than home kitchens. Look for sturdy handles, stable bases, and materials that hold up to daily operation, especially in shared spaces.

Who Should Buy Which Commercial Coffee Makers for Workplaces?

If you need coffee for a small office or department, a 12-cup brewer is usually the most practical choice. For conference rooms, staff lunches, and medium breakrooms, a mid-capacity urn offers a better balance of output and footprint. Large teams, catering operations, and event-heavy workplaces should consider the biggest urns, especially if they need one machine to serve many people quickly. In short, the best Commercial Coffee Makers for Workplaces are the ones that match your daily volume, staffing, and cleanup needs rather than just the highest advertised capacity.
